Output 3052c8f0218060f8158267b23528c2bcd93f247ae9e3f36f47a4cc305c54f4f5:0

value
4683760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e6ac9eab7b512c1e2d59bb743b757e0fc6e07c OP_EQUAL
address
3AhxUsf6YbSeCDe6BcwKCBKS1AFF8JPneS
transaction
3052c8f0218060f8158267b23528c2bcd93f247ae9e3f36f47a4cc305c54f4f5
spent
true